In 1876, Levi Yocum entered the world in Washington County, Kentucky, USA, born to John Joseph Yocom And Martha Walls. In 1880, Levi Yocum resided in Palmyra, Trimble, Kentucky, USA. In 1910, Levi Yocum resided in Palmyra, Trimble, Kentucky. Levi Yocum married Mary Campbell, and had children including Bessie Yocum, Clara Yocum, Martha Yocum, Maude Yocum, Ruben M Ruby Yocum, Willie Elmo Yocum. Levi Yocum passed away in 1936 in Carrollton, Carroll County, Kentucky, United States of America.
